Definition

Quick Definition(Strong's Concordance)

to dash down

a primitive root;

Full Lexicon Entry(Abbott-Smith)
  1. to dash to pieces 1a) (Piel) to dash in pieces 1b) (Pual) to be dashed in pieces

Key Passages

2 Kings 8:12BSB

“Why is my lord weeping?” asked Hazael.“Because I know the evil you will do to the Israelites,” Elisha replied. “You will set fire to their fortresses, kill their young men with the sword, dash their little ones to pieces, and rip open their pregnant women.”

Hosea 10:14BSB

the roar of battle will rise against your people,so that all your fortresses will be demolishedas Shalman devastated Beth-arbelin the day of battle,when mothers were dashed to piecesalong with their children.

Isaiah 13:16BSB

Their infants will be dashed to piecesbefore their eyes,their houses will be looted,and their wives will be ravished.

Isaiah 13:18BSB

Their bows will dash young men to pieces;they will have no mercy on the fruit of the womb;they will not look with pity on the children.
